Reach Subsea is an offshore contractor that provides subsea services, ocean data, and engineering solutions. The company specializes in survey, monitoring, and inspection, repair, and maintenance (IRMR) services for clients primarily in the energy and offshore sectors. It operates a fleet of remotely operated vehicles (ROVs) and is a pioneer in uncrewed surface vessels (USVs) through its Reach Remote program, which enables remote subsea operations. Key services include support for the full life cycle of offshore cables, pipeline inspections, site surveys, and advanced reservoir monitoring using proprietary technologies. Reach Subsea focuses on delivering integrated, turn-key solutions for complex underwater projects, leveraging advanced technology to enhance data acquisition and operational efficiency.
